Background
Anastas Kondo was born on 28 November 1937 in Kuçovë, Albania, and hailed from a family from Vuno, in Himarë municipality, on the Albanian riviera.

He studied in the Saint St. Petersburg State Institute of Technology and graduated there as a geologist.
Kondo became one of the main textbook authors and undertook several scientific studies on micropaleontology in Albania. Kondo has been the screenwriter of movies such as Misioni përtej detit, Dimri i madh, Kur zbardhi një ditë, Partizani i vogël Velo, et cetera He has been a Deputy Minister of Education as well as secretary of the Albanian League of Writers and Artists.
Died in 2006.
He has won national prizes on several books published such as the short stories volumes Ura (The bridge), Kur mbaron e vdes burri (When the man finishes and dies), Portat e diellit (The gates to the sun), Pse e vranë Odisenë (Why was Odissey killed), Njerëz dhe gurë (Men and stones), Kur zbardhi një ditë (A day"s dawn).
